jidanni@jidanni.org writes:

> The warning
>   Source file `...' newer than byte-compiled file
> isn't clear about which one ends up getting used.
>
> It should say
>   Source file `...' newer than byte-compiled file, using it.
>
> Wait, that isn't clear either.
> It should say
>   Source file `...' newer than byte-compiled file, using the former / or
>   / using the latter / or something like that.

That's a good point.  I realised that I wasn't 100% sure myself what
Emacs actually does in these cases, but it seems like it's using the
(older) .elc file.  I've now made it say so.
